This portfolio is specific to ENG 105, an Advanced English course at Arizona State University. The course focuses on the Learning Goals designed by folx at The Writers' Studio and the Habits of Mind. In brief, the Learning Goals are as follows: rhetorical understanding and practicing, critical languaging, and composing as a process. In this course I'll aim to better integrate these goals and habits into my writing by means of reflective self-assessment, peer review, instructor feedback, and then applying that support strategically.
Habits of Mind are practical ways of learning and assessing learning, which makes them a natural adjunct to the more philosophical Learning Goals. The Habits of Mind are as follows: curiosity, openness, engagement, creativity, persistence, and responsibility. Another key element of ENG 105 is the emphasis on multimodality. Multimodality is a difficult concept to define because different writers will manifest it differently in their work. To me, it means applying the advantages of technology to enhance written works or to go about what would traditionally be a written work in an adjacent medium, such as a podcast. Some benefits to be gained by incorporating multimodality could include greater persuasiveness, a wider reach for one work, and the artistic satisfaction of having attempted a new way of writing.
